ESV
And the priest shall offer the burnt offering and the grain offering on the altar. Thus the priest shall make atonement for him, and he shall be clean.
NIV
and offer it on the altar, together with the grain offering, and make atonement for him, and he will be clean.
NLT
and offer it on the altar along with the grain offering. Through this process, the priest will purify the person who was healed, and the person will be ceremonially clean.
